Electric Picnic begins today with a record 70,000 people attending after a 2-year Covid-hiatus.

However, forecasters warn that this year's festival goers may want to pack sensibly, as this year's festival is likely to turn into a ‘mudfest’ due to heavy overnight rain.

Met Eireann Forecaster Matthew Martin joined Jonathan Healy on the show.
